Backend Engineer
California City, USA
Full time
Remote
Compensation is not specified
Role
Backend Engineer
Description
About us:
DoraHacks is seeking a skilled professional to join our team. We are a global hackathon organizer and an active developer incentive platform. We foster a global hacker community in blockchain, quantum computing, and space tech. Our goal is to support developers worldwide in collaborating, funding their ideas, and building through various avenues such as hackathons, bounties, grants, idea networks, and developer games.
Responsibilities
- Develop, test, and maintain backend APIs.
- Design and optimize database structures, proficiently managing data using MySQL and MongoDB.
- Ensure data collection and processing adhere to security standards, upholding data integrity and privacy.
- Research and implement blockchain technology to enhance data flow and transaction processes.
- Contribute to system architecture design for improved system performance and scalability.
- Collaborate closely with the frontend development team to ensure seamless API integration and operation.
- Produce comprehensive technical documentation.
Requirements
- Proficiency in Mandarin for verbal communication (written skills not mandatory).
- Bachelor's degree or higher in Computer Science or related field.
- Proficiency in Golang, C++, or Python.
- Minimum of 3 years of backend development experience.
- Knowledge of MySQL and MongoDB databases coupled with practical project experience.
- Strong grasp of data collection, security, and processing principles, with the ability to implement them effectively.
- Basic understanding of blockchain technology; candidates with project experience in this area are preferred.
- Familiarity with RESTful API design and implementation; knowledge of GraphQL is a bonus.
- Excellent problem-solving abilities and teamwork skills.
- Strong motivation to learn and adapt, keeping up with technological advancements.
Preferred Qualifications
- Experience in smart contract development.
- Proficiency in developing and optimizing high-concurrency servers.
- Understanding of frontend development or related technologies.
- Possessing AI experience is advantageous, with knowledge of AI/ML concepts and tools to enhance product functionality and development processes.
Skills Required
Dorahacks
Website
dorahacks.ioCompany size
Not specified
Location
United States
Description
Bring the twenty-second century technologies to the present, use them wisely, and make them open source. Explore the world of hackathons, grants, bounties, ideas, and more.